Position Summary

Doonan Specialized Trailer is seeking motivated and dependable Production Assemblers to join our manufacturing team on both Day and Night Shifts .

Production Assemblers are responsible for assembling prefabricated steel and aluminum components to build large commercial trailers. This position involves working from blueprints and templates while using a variety of hand tools, power tools, machines, and material-handling equipment.

The ideal candidate is mechanically inclined, comfortable working with tools, pays close attention to detail, and takes pride in producing quality work.

Essential Responsibilities

- Read and follow blueprints, drawings, templates, and work instructions

- Assemble prefabricated metal and aluminum components to build commercial trailers

- Lay out, fit, drill, screw, bolt, and rivet metal sheeting, frames, bars, and angle clips

- Use pneumatic and hydraulic hand tools and other power equipment

- Assemble and bolt trailer undercarriages into position

- Mount tires and wheels

- Drill, tap, ream, countersink, and spot-face holes using drill presses and portable power drills

- Operate drill presses, punch presses, riveting machines, and other production equipment

- Safely operate small cranes and lifting equipment to transport or position large components

- Use hand files, scrapers, and other tools to achieve proper fit and finish between components

- Install trailer lights, electrical components, and customer options

- Assemble and install various trailer components and accessories

- Assist with the salvage and reassembly of components such as power brake boosters, air-brake compressors, and valves

- Maintain a clean, organized, and safe work environment

- Follow all company safety procedures and quality standards
